Crafting Time DT ... Buttons and Bows

 This week's theme over at Crafting Time this week is buttons and bows.  I instantly thought of haberdashery and sewing ...
 I covered a square peice of white cardstock in Tim Holtz tissue tape and then distressed it using aged mahogany and vintage photo distress inks.  The elements from the Tim Holtz stamp set were stamped onto cardsock using black archival ink and distressed using spiced marmalade, fired brick and aged mahogany distress inks before being cut out.  I added this fab ball trim ribbon, a button that I stained in cranberry and red pepper alcohol ink, and some little bows to finish.

I also made a collage tag using the same stamp set.
Having stamped some of the elements in brushed corduray and fired brick distress inks, I distressed the tag using tea dye, vintage photo and aged mahogany distress inks.  I stamped the manikin in aged mahogany distress ink and added a bow.  The wooden button was roughly stained with aged mahogany distress ink and some twine threaded through and tied into a bow.  Finally I added some of that fab ball trim ribbon, and some seam binding stained in aged mahogany distress ink.

 And as I am thinking about buttons and bows ... I love simple, quick, embossed cards ...
 I used my sizzix embossing folder to create the texture for this card.  The mannikin is a freebie stamp from a craft magazine, and I cut it out.  I added some flat backed pearls, black gingham, a big bow with a button at the centre and a pin.  Very simples.
